A putative mechanism that switches brain pathology from anxiety to depression discovered

Researchers discovered a novel brain mechanism that links anxiety and depression, showing unique cellular mechanisms activate as one pathology progresses into another. The 'switch' involves astrocytes and cytoskeletal mechanisms, which may be targeted for new classes of psychotropic drugs.

BU study discovers connection between contact sports, CTE and troubling sleep behaviors

Researchers found a connection between contact sports participation and chronic traumatic encephalopathy (CTE) leading to sleep dysfunction. The study revealed that tau pathology in brainstem nuclei is more strongly associated with sleep symptoms than Lewy body pathology, suggesting a new link between CTE and REM sleep behavior disorder.

McKee CTE staging scheme accurate in diagnosing severity, location of disease

A new study proves that the McKee CTE staging scheme accurately represents the progression of tau pathology in CTE, correlating with clinical dementia and age at death. Researchers found five brain regions with increasing p-tau pathology that conform to CTE stage, age, and years of football play.

Deadly bacterial infection in pigs deciphered

Researchers at the University of Bern have discovered how Clostridium perfringens causes fatal intestinal bleeding in piglets. The toxin attaches to CD31, a key molecule on endothelial cells, leading to cell death and damage to blood vessels.

Extracellular vesicles play an important role in the pathology of malaria vivax

Extracellular vesicles play a key role in the pathology of malaria vivax by promoting parasite adhesion to human spleen fibroblasts. The study found that EVs induce the expression of ICAM-1 on fibroblast surfaces, serving as an anchor for parasite-infected red blood cell adherence.

Is the simplest chemical reaction really that simple?

Researchers at the Dalian Institute of Chemical Physics found clear quantum interference in the H + HD reaction, verifying that Nature plays dice. The study reveals a new roaming mechanism, which occurs only 0.3% of the time, and highlights the complexity of chemical reactions.
